Intent / boundary record:

  • intent: make editable voids a clean Slate v2 architecture story now that same-runtime multi-root support exists.
  • target user: raw Slate authors who need native/app controls or optional rich content inside an atomic editor island; Plate/plugin authors who need a substrate they can wrap without raw Slate owning product UX.
  • outcome: canonical docs/examples and public primitives teach native controls and rich child content inside islands without app-land nested editor hacks.
  • Slate core owns: element void kind semantics, keyed root storage, child-root lifecycle, deterministic root dirty metadata, snapshot/history integration, and serialization policy hooks.
  • slate-react owns: root view hooks, focus/selection routing, event ownership, root-scoped subscriptions, and the helper that turns an element plus slot into a renderable root target.
  • slate-dom owns: DOM hit testing, selection import/export, clipboard/drop DOM boundary handling, and spacer/void bridge behavior.
  • app/Plate owns: labels, validation, form layouts, menus, product widgets, schema-specific field UX, and whether scalar fields are local UI state or Slate document state fields.
  • in-scope: child-root identity, lifecycle, selection/focus/history, clipboard, delete/undo/move, scalar state fields, example shape, proof plan, and conservative issue accounting.
  • non-goals: Plate form-builder APIs, current-version Plate adapters, current-version slate-yjs adapters, automatic child roots for every island, rich child-root content as normal void element children, fat renderVoid props, and implementation before user acceptance.
  • root ordering boundary: this plan does not migrate roots from a keyed record to an ordered array. Child-root display order is owned by the parent document position of the island element; child-root storage/identity is keyed. Any separate top-level root ordering API belongs in a distinct multi-root model plan.
  • decision boundaries: Slate Plan may choose architecture/API target and proof gates; user review is required before implementation; final API names remain provisional until ecosystem and pressure passes complete.
  • revision triggers: change this decision only if ecosystem/source review proves same-runtime child roots cannot preserve history/selection/collab semantics, or if a smaller primitive can provide the same guarantees without fat render props, void children, or nested independent editors.

Decision brief:

  • non-negotiable decision: keep editable-island as an atomic parent-flow void shell; add an explicit same-runtime child-root primitive for rich island content; use state fields for document-owned scalar metadata; keep renderVoid content-only; keep nested independent editors as interop proof, not canonical DX.
  • principles: runtime identity must outlive paths; render callbacks render content; runtime operations live in hooks/context; parent flow atomics and child rich roots have distinct ownership; raw Slate provides substrate, not product widgets; behavior must be regression-proof in browser tests.
  • top drivers: multi-root support makes nested independent editors unnecessary as canonical DX; void selection/focus/clipboard issues are historically fragile; collaboration and history need deterministic root lifecycle semantics; current roots are keyed records and this plan should not hide a roots-ordering migration inside the island feature.
  • chosen option: child root primitive keyed by stable element identity plus slot, rendered through <Editable root={childRoot}>, with scalar document-owned island data stored in state fields.
  • accepted constraints: child root creation is opt-in; child roots are not void children; child-root display order follows the parent island position; root values remain keyed until a separate top-level ordering plan says otherwise.
  • rejected option: keep nested independent editor canonical. Reason: it duplicates runtime, history, selection, clipboard, serialization, and collab ownership; it should survive as a regression/interop example only.
  • rejected option: store rich content under void element children. Reason: it muddies parent selection/delete/normalization and fights the existing void kind contract.
  • rejected option: path-derived child root ids. Reason: paths move on edit, undo, drag/drop, and collaboration.
  • rejected option: automatic child root for every island. Reason: most islands are native controls and should not pay root lifecycle/serialization cost.
  • rejected option: fat renderVoid props with path/actions/children/focus. Reason: current surface contracts explicitly keep render props content-only; adding runtime operations there would make rendering a subscription API.
  • consequences: new lifecycle, serialization, copy/paste, delete/undo, move/drop, and collab proof are mandatory; example DX becomes better only if the public helper is minimal; issue claims stay conservative until behavior proof exists.
  • follow-ups: settle public naming; specify child-root serialization/copy/paste policy; specify yjs/collab root payload ordering; decide whether child-root helper belongs in slate-react only or needs a core identity companion.

Research/live-source refresh notes:

  • React does not change the architecture direction. It sharpens it: child-root React wiring must be external-store/selector-first and command/event-handler driven, with effects only for external synchronization.
  • ProseMirror, Tiptap, and Lexical all support the same broad shape from different angles: explicit widget boundary, stable identity, centralized transaction/update ownership, and wrapper DX outside the core model.
  • Plate source is a strong boundary argument, not a reason to widen raw Slate. Product APIs, options stores, handlers, components, uploads, labels, and validation belong there.
  • slate-yjs is the red flag. It does not veto child roots, but it makes deterministic child-root create/delete/move/copy payloads non-negotiable before any collab claim.

Final user-review handoff:

  • recommended architecture: keep editable-island as an atomic parent-flow void shell; add opt-in same-runtime child roots for rich island content.
  • public API target: useSlateChildRoot(element, slot = 'default') returns the root target for <Editable root={childRoot} />.
  • scalar metadata: document-owned scalar fields use state fields; ephemeral app UI can stay local React state.
  • render contract: keep renderVoid content-only. No path/actions/focus/child prop bag.
  • runtime rule: child-root lifecycle must be core operation payload or transaction metadata, not React effect-owned derived state.
  • performance rule: no root for native controls, O(1) root/slot lookup, no every-root/every-island commit scans.
  • migration rule: nested independent editors stay as interop/regression proof, not canonical rich editable-island DX.
  • collab rule: no slate-yjs/current-collab claim until deterministic child-root create/delete/move/copy payload and replay policy is proven.
  • issue accounting: #5212 is related/planned example work only; no new Fixes or Improves line is legal before implementation and browser proof.
